Hi all,

I have quite a few green bell peppers growing that have been the same size and colour since June. As they haven't turned red I'm wondering if they ever will. DOes anyone have any experience of this and if there is anything that can be done? Thanks!

Easy answer when they are ready.

Peppers are daylight neutral plants, by this they have a set time scale from growing to fruiting/ ripening etc and are not bothered by an increase or decrease in light levels as in some other plants, generally I find sweet peppers take a little longer than hot peppers to go into ripening stages.
I am growing Trinidad Perfume as my sweet pepper and they are now just starting to change where as many of my hot peppers I have been munching on for a few weeks now.
